So I see 600 and 800 series steering boxes offering 12.7:1 ratios. I have no clue what our stock GN has. Currently I have Spohn upper/lower fronts and rears/Spohn F/R pro Tour sways/bilstein shocks. I'd love to quicken up the steering box but I know so little about them. Anyone with first hand experience? What are the CON's using the smaller, lighter version. Some offer both versions. Prices very from $500ish range to near $900ish range. Thanks for any "real world" advice.

Hi Robert,

We have sold many of the 600 gear boxes and also installed a bunch over the years. The 600 steering gear box is a definite improvement over the stock box. The stock box on the Turbo Regal's were quick ratio boxes to begin with but have gotten sloppy over the years. Also the stock steering shaft with the old rag joint needs to go to improve everything as a whole.
 
The stock GN runs a 14:1 box (800). It is a faster ratio than a regular Regal at 16:1. The 12.7:1 would be nice upgrade.
The 600 boxes are a much newer design, and use actual rack and pinion valving which give them a much better "feel" than an 800. However, the 12.7:1 600 boxes are in Very short supply. Part of the reason prices across the board have gone up so much in recent months. I would say, if you find a 600 in 12.7:1, grab it while you can.
